Historic Triumph: Guinness MatchDay Hosts Grand Season Finale as Arsenal Claims First Premier League Title in 22 Years


As millions of fans worldwide celebrated Arsenal’s historic Premier League championship after a 22-year wait, Guinness, the Official Beer of the Premier League and Official Global Partner of Arsenal, hosted an unforgettable season finale watch party. Gathering over 500 passionate Arsenal supporters and football lovers at Guinness HQ in Lagos, with a simultaneous watch party at Abuja, the night was a great celebration of triumph and premium enjoyment.
Sunday’s grand finale marked the culmination of a monumental season-long series of Guinness MatchDay viewing parties. Throughout the season, the brand successfully brought genuine stadium energy to bars and 3rd spaces in over 10 cities, including Awka, Portharcout, Ibadan, uniting more than 10,000 passionate fans and Guinness consumers in shared football experiences.
On the Premier League Finale, the energy was off the roof as fans watched Arsenal secure a gritty 2-1 victory. The main event at Guinness HQ, Lagos, delivered a huge football celebration, amplified by the presence of top entertainment personalities and BBN stars like Koyin, Bella, and Prince in Lagos, while Dede’s presence lit up the Abuja venue. Hosted by dynamic sports influencer Chief SUO, the evening perfectly captured the roaring energy of devoted Arsenal fans who had waited over two decades for this milestone.
